Coherent 's sensitive PowerMax sensors based on silicon, germanium photodiodes or sensitive thermophilic layers are designed for measuring very low laser powers where high resolution (sensitivity) is required.
Features
- Very wide spectral range of 0.19 to 11,000 µm
- Aperture up to 19mm
- Measurement range from 10 nW to 2 W depending on model
- Variants with USB or RS-232 interface where no meter is needed
- Sensors are compatible with LabMax-Pro, LabMax-TOP/TO, FieldMaxII-TOP/TO/P and FieldMate meters.
Variants
- Sensors based on semiconductor (silicon or germanium) photodiodes for the most sensitive low power measurements, convection cooling (passive air)
- Thermophilic thermocouple-based sensors for broad-spectrum measurements of smaller powers, convection cooling (passive air)
